SPACE HOP

Space Hop is all about encouraging young children to read more books.  You have to read 6 books.  At the start you get a poster.  Then you get as many books as you want.  After you read all your books you pick your two favourites.  You do this three times.  Then you will have read a total of six books.  You write your two favourites on you poster and under it you will find a box with one star, two stars or three stars.

One star means the book was okay.  Two stars means the book was good.  Three stars means the book was brilliant.  When you have finished you get a medal.  My favourite book this year was Sleepovers.

Our school “Patronage” has now been handed over to the bishop of Ferns by the Mercy Order. While this will make no real difference to the day to day running of the school it does mark the end of a long era of involvement by the Sisters of Mercy in education in Wexford. We will mark this occasion on September 29th when we have our Prayer Service for the beginning of the school year. We have invited members of the Mercy Order to join us for this occasion.
